>> On 18/01/2019 07:47, Slavica Djukic via GitGitGadget wrote:
>>> From: Slavica Djukic <slawica92@hotmail.com>
>>>
>>> Implement show-help command in add-interactive.c and use it in
>>> builtin add--helper.c.
>>>
>>> Use command name "show-help" instead of "help": add--helper is
>>> builtin, hence add--helper --help would be intercepted by
>>> handle_builtin and re-routed to the help command, without ever
>>> calling cmd_add__helper().

>>> +void add_i_show_help(void)
>>> +{
>>> +	const char *help_color = get_color(COLOR_HELP);
>>> +	color_fprintf(stdout, help_color, "%s%s", _("status"),
>>> +		N_("        - show paths with changes"));
>>> +	printf("\n");
>> There seems to be a bit of confusion with the translation of these
>> messages. "status" does not want to be translated so it shouldn't be in
>> _() - it can just go in the format string as can the indentation and the
>> "\n" (or we could use color_fprintf_ln() to automatically add a newline
>> at the end. N_() is used to mark static strings for translation so the
>> gettext utilities pick up the text to be translated but (because
>> initializes for static variables must be compile-time constants) does
>> not do anything when the program runs - if you have 'const char *s =
>> N_(hello);' you have to do '_(s)' to get the translated version. Here we
>> can just pass the untranslated string directly to gettext so it should
>> be _("show paths with changes"). Putting all that together we get
>>
>> 	color_fprintf(stdout, help_color, "status        - %s\n",
>> 			_("show paths with changes");
> 
> 
> I thought _() was for strings that were already translated,
> and N_() for strings that weren't. And I now see that I also tried to
> translate command names as well, just the opposite of what you suggested...
 > Thanks for clarifying this.

I hope my explanation made sense, feel free to email if you want to 
check anything.

Having thought about it, I don't think we should add "\n" to the format 
string as it means the color will be reset after the new line, it should 
use color_fprintf_ln() instead which adds a new line after it has reset 
the color.
